La imagen puede ser una representación.
Consulte las especificaciones para obtener detalles del producto.
EFM32WG995F256-BGA120T

EFM32WG995F256-BGA120T

Product Overview

Category

The EFM32WG995F256-BGA120T belongs to the category of microcontrollers.

Use

This microcontroller is designed for various embedded applications, including Internet of Things (IoT) devices, consumer electronics, industrial automation, and smart energy management systems.

Characteristics

  • Low power consumption: The EFM32WG995F256-BGA120T is known for its exceptional energy efficiency, making it suitable for battery-powered devices.
  • High performance: With a 32-bit ARM Cortex-M4 core running at up to 48 MHz, this microcontroller offers fast processing capabilities.
  • Extensive peripheral integration: It features a wide range of peripherals, such as UART, SPI, I2C, USB, ADC, and GPIO, enabling seamless connectivity and functionality.
  • Ample memory: The microcontroller has 256 KB of flash memory and 64 KB of RAM, providing sufficient storage for program code and data.

Package and Quantity

The EFM32WG995F256-BGA120T comes in a BGA120T package. Each package contains one microcontroller.

Specifications

  • Microcontroller core: ARM Cortex-M4
  • Clock speed: Up to 48 MHz
  • Flash memory: 256 KB
  • RAM: 64 KB
  • Operating voltage: 1.8V - 3.8V
  • Operating temperature range: -40°C to +85°C
  • Peripherals: UART, SPI, I2C, USB, ADC, GPIO, etc.
  • Package type: BGA120T

Detailed Pin Configuration

The EFM32WG995F256-BGA120T microcontroller has a total of 120 pins. The pin configuration is as follows:

(Pin diagram or table can be included here)

Functional Features

  • Low power modes: The microcontroller offers various low power modes, allowing for efficient energy management and extended battery life.
  • Advanced connectivity: With built-in UART, SPI, I2C, and USB interfaces, the EFM32WG995F256-BGA120T enables seamless communication with other devices.
  • Analog-to-digital conversion: It features an integrated ADC, enabling accurate measurement of analog signals.
  • GPIO flexibility: The microcontroller provides a significant number of general-purpose input/output pins, allowing for versatile interfacing with external components.

Advantages and Disadvantages

Advantages

  • Energy-efficient design prolongs battery life in portable applications.
  • High-performance ARM Cortex-M4 core ensures fast and reliable processing.
  • Extensive peripheral integration simplifies system design and reduces component count.
  • Ample memory capacity accommodates complex applications.

Disadvantages

  • BGA package may require specialized equipment for soldering and rework.
  • Limited availability of alternative models from other manufacturers.

Working Principles

The EFM32WG995F256-BGA120T operates based on the principles of a typical microcontroller. It executes instructions stored in its flash memory, interacts with peripherals, and communicates with external devices through various interfaces. The microcontroller's working principles are governed by its firmware, which is developed using appropriate programming languages and tools.

Detailed Application Field Plans

The EFM32WG995F256-BGA120T microcontroller finds application in various fields, including: - Internet of Things (IoT) devices: Enables connectivity and control in smart home systems, wearable devices, and environmental monitoring solutions. - Consumer electronics: Powers a wide range of products such as smart appliances, remote controls, and gaming consoles. - Industrial automation: Facilitates automation and control in manufacturing processes, robotics, and industrial monitoring systems. - Smart energy management: Enables efficient energy monitoring and control in smart grids, renewable energy systems, and power management solutions.

Detailed and Complete Alternative Models

While the EFM32WG995F256-BGA120T is a highly capable microcontroller, alternative models from other manufacturers can also be considered. Some notable alternatives include: - STM32F407VG: A microcontroller from STMicroelectronics with similar specifications and features. - LPC1768: A microcontroller from NXP Semiconductors offering comparable performance and peripheral integration. - PIC32MZ2048EFH144: A microcontroller from Microchip Technology with a powerful 32-bit MIPS core and extensive peripheral support.

These alternative models provide similar functionality and can be suitable replacements depending on specific project requirements.

(Note: The content provided above is a sample structure for an encyclopedia entry and may not reflect actual specifications or details of the mentioned microcontroller.)

Enumere 10 preguntas y respuestas comunes relacionadas con la aplicación de EFM32WG995F256-BGA120T en soluciones técnicas

Sure! Here are 10 common questions and answers related to the application of EFM32WG995F256-BGA120T in technical solutions:

  1. Q: What is EFM32WG995F256-BGA120T? A: EFM32WG995F256-BGA120T is a microcontroller from Silicon Labs' EFM32 Wonder Gecko series, featuring an ARM Cortex-M4 core and various peripherals.

  2. Q: What are the key features of EFM32WG995F256-BGA120T? A: Some key features include 256KB Flash memory, 64KB RAM, advanced energy management system, multiple communication interfaces, and a wide range of peripherals.

  3. Q: What are the typical applications of EFM32WG995F256-BGA120T? A: EFM32WG995F256-BGA120T is commonly used in applications such as industrial automation, smart energy, home automation, Internet of Things (IoT), and wearable devices.

  4. Q: How can I program EFM32WG995F256-BGA120T? A: EFM32WG995F256-BGA120T can be programmed using various development tools, including the Simplicity Studio IDE, which supports C programming and provides debugging capabilities.

  5. Q: What communication interfaces are available on EFM32WG995F256-BGA120T? A: EFM32WG995F256-BGA120T offers several communication interfaces, including UART, SPI, I2C, USB, CAN, and Ethernet.

  6. Q: Can EFM32WG995F256-BGA120T operate on low power? A: Yes, EFM32WG995F256-BGA120T is designed for low-power operation and includes features like energy modes, sleep modes, and peripheral reflex system to optimize power consumption.

  7. Q: Does EFM32WG995F256-BGA120T support real-time operating systems (RTOS)? A: Yes, EFM32WG995F256-BGA120T is compatible with popular RTOS like FreeRTOS, Micrium OS, and embOS, allowing for efficient multitasking and real-time applications.

  8. Q: Can I use EFM32WG995F256-BGA120T for wireless communication? A: Yes, EFM32WG995F256-BGA120T supports wireless communication through its various interfaces, such as UART, SPI, and I2C, which can be used with external wireless modules.

  9. Q: Are there any development boards available for EFM32WG995F256-BGA120T? A: Yes, Silicon Labs offers development kits like the EFM32WG-STK3800, which provide a convenient platform for prototyping and evaluating EFM32WG995F256-BGA120T.

  10. Q: Where can I find more resources and documentation for EFM32WG995F256-BGA120T? A: You can find detailed datasheets, application notes, software examples, and other resources on Silicon Labs' website or the official EFM32 community forums.